TEXT ORDER: Petitioner Jose Gabriel Torres Duran filed a Petition for Writ of Habeas Corpus pursuant to 28 U.S.C. § 2241 alleging he is unlawfully detained by immigration authorities under 8 U.S.C. § 1225(b). D.E. 1 ("Petition"). Along with his Petition Petitioner also filed a motion for a temporary restraining order seeking an order enjoining his transfer or removal from outside the District of New Jersey and for his immediate release. D.E. 2 ("TRO Motion"). It is ORDERED that, if Respondents contest Petitioner's factual allegations and/or contend that Petitioner has a criminal record and/or assert this case is distinguishable from the cases in this district previously addressing § 1225, they shall file an expedited answer to the Petition within five days of the date of entry of this Order, and Petitioner may file a reply within three days of the date of filing of Respondents' expedited answer. If Respondents do not file expedited answer, under this Court's decision in Lomeu v. Soto, No. 25-16589, 2025 WL 2981296, at *9 (D.N.J. Oct. 23, 2025), and other recent decisions in this District interpreting § 1225, including Rivera Zumba v. Bondi, No. 25-14626, 2025 WL 2753496(D.N.J. Sept. 26, 2025) (interpreting § 1225(b)(2)), Rivas Rodriguez v. Rokosky, No. 25-17419, 2025 WL 3485628 (D.N.J. Dec. 3, 2025) (interpreting § 1225(b)(1)), accepting Petitioner's allegations as true, the Court holds Petitioner's mandatory detention under Section 1225(b) is unlawful and further violates his liberty interest protected by the Due Process Clause of the Fifth Amendment. If Respondents do not file an expedited answer in opposition, they shall instead release Petitioner within five days of this order and file a written notice of Petitioner's release within three days. If Respondents subsequently detain Petitioner under 8 U.S.C. § 1226(a), they shall comply with the regulations at 8 C.F.R. § 236.1(c)(8) and (d). The Clerk shall DISMISS as MOOT the TRO Motion, D.E. 2, because the Court has enjoined Petitioner transfer from New Jersey and ordered an expedited resolution of this matter. So Ordered by Judge Evelyn Padin on 5/20/2026. (bt) (Entered: 05/20/2026)
